- •POTATO BATTERY KIT - This STEM science kit teaches kids about electricity with the components they need to build a DIY potato clock with voltmeter. Easy-to-follow instructions let kids get started right away, all they need is two potatoes!
- •COIN POWERED FLASHLIGHT - The science experiments for kids in this kit continue with an amazing penny flashlight. Kids will construct a battery with the included "coins" and see the electric circuit come to life when they turn on the flashlight.
- •ASTOUNDING SCIENCE EXPERIMENTS - This combination of STEM labs give kids the chance to learn about electrical engineering in a fun, hands-on, and memorable way. This is a great science gift for any curious kid that loves to build and explore!
- •SO MUCH TO LEARN - Not only will kids make a battery and a complete electrical circuit, they'll also learn why these things work. Our detailed learning guide provides fascinating insight into the science of electricity, circuits, and more.
